La. Ch. Code art. 703

This is the official text of La. Ch. Code art. 703, part of Louisiana’s Children's Code — governs child custody, child protection, and juvenile justice in Louisiana.

Notice

Official statutory text

Written notice of the date, time, and place of the dispositional hearing shall be served and a return made in the same manner as a petition on all parties and counsel of record at least fifteen days prior to the hearing, unless the parties have been previously notified in open court at a prior hearing.

Acts 1991, No. 235, ยง6, eff. Jan. 1, 1992.
